Abstract
In a file-generating device, the image acquiring unit is configured to acquire image data indicating an original image. The generating unit is configured to generate a document file having no data to specify a page, by using the image data. The printer data acquiring unit is configured to acquire a prescribed size of a sheet that is used by a target printer and a first margin corresponding to the prescribed size of the sheet. The target printer is to print the original image on a recording sheet based on the document file. The printable region determining unit is configured to determine a printable region within which the target printer is configured to print an image on the sheet, based on the prescribed size of the sheet and the first margin. The generating unit generates the document file such that the original image is positioned within the printable region.
